At a Glance
- Tasks: Design and deliver high-impact software solutions that delight thousands of users.
- Company: Join a dynamic tech company in London with a focus on innovation.
- Benefits: Competitive salary, flexible working, and opportunities for professional growth.
- Why this job: Shape the future of our platform and tackle exciting technical challenges.
- Qualifications: Advanced skills in Full Stack Development, especially with Node.js and modern frontend frameworks.
- Other info: Collaborative environment with a strong emphasis on mentorship and continuous learning.
The predicted salary is between 60000 - 84000 £ per year.
We are expanding our engineering team to boost our development capacity and take our product to the next level. As a Senior Full Stack Engineer, you’ll play a central role in shaping the technical direction of our platform, building high-quality features, influencing system architecture, and ensuring we deliver a product that’s efficient, robust, and a delight for thousands of customers to use. You’ll work closely with Product, Design, and customers to deeply understand problems, translate them into elegant technical solutions, and help decide not only what we build but how we build it for long-term success.
Key Responsibilities
- Building powerful features – Design and deliver high-impact solutions that are clean, scalable, and built to last, delighting thousands of customers.
- Shaping the big picture – Work with Product, Design, and customers to define what we build and how we build it for long-term success.
- Keeping things running smoothly – Maintain, optimise, and secure our systems so they perform at their best, even at scale.
- Problem-solving like a pro – Lead the charge on tricky technical challenges, turning complex problems into elegant, maintainable solutions.
- Mentoring and leading – Support and guide other engineers, sharing knowledge and raising the technical bar for the team.
- Staying ahead of the game – Keep up with new tools, trends, and best practices, helping us continuously evolve our stack and processes.
- Owning your work end-to-end – Take full responsibility from initial idea to production, making sure every detail delivers value to users.
Skills, Knowledge and Expertise
- Hard skills – Full Stack Development: Advanced skills with Node.js (Express/Nest.js) and modern frontend frameworks like Vue/Nuxt or React/Next, building smooth, scalable experiences end-to-end.
- TypeScript
Senior Full Stack Engineer employer: Zinc
Contact Detail:
Zinc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Full Stack Engineer
✨Tip Number 1
Network like a pro! Reach out to your connections in the tech industry, especially those who work at companies you're interested in. A friendly chat can lead to referrals, which can significantly boost your chances of landing that Senior Full Stack Engineer role.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your best projects, especially those that highlight your full stack development expertise. Make sure to include links to your GitHub or any live demos so potential employers can see your work in action.
✨Tip Number 3
Prepare for technical interviews by brushing up on your problem-solving skills. Practice coding challenges and system design questions that are relevant to full stack development. This will help you feel confident and ready to tackle any tricky questions that come your way.
✨Tip Number 4
Don’t forget to apply through our website! We love seeing applications directly from candidates who are excited about joining our team. Plus, it gives you a chance to showcase your enthusiasm for the role and the company right from the start.
We think you need these skills to ace Senior Full Stack Engineer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V reflects the skills and experiences that align with the Senior Full Stack Engineer role. Highlight your expertise in Node.js, TypeScript, and any frontend frameworks you've worked with. We want to see how you can contribute to our team!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Share your passion for full stack development and how you’ve tackled complex problems in the past. Let us know why you’re excited about joining StudySmarter and how you can help us take our product to the next level.
Showcase Your Projects: If you have any personal or professional projects that demonstrate your skills, don’t hesitate to include them. We love seeing real examples of your work, especially those that highlight your ability to build clean and scalable solutions.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it shows you’re keen on being part of our team at StudySmarter!
How to prepare for a job interview at Zinc
✨Know Your Tech Stack Inside Out
Make sure you’re well-versed in Node.js, TypeScript, and the frontend frameworks mentioned in the job description. Be ready to discuss your past projects and how you’ve used these technologies to solve real-world problems.
✨Showcase Your Problem-Solving Skills
Prepare to talk about specific technical challenges you've faced and how you approached them. Use the STAR method (Situation, Task, Action, Result) to structure your answers and highlight your ability to turn complex issues into elegant solutions.
✨Understand the Bigger Picture
Familiarise yourself with the company’s product and its users. Think about how your role as a Senior Full Stack Engineer can influence the overall direction of the platform and be ready to share your vision on how to enhance user experience.
✨Be Ready to Mentor
Since mentoring is part of the role, think of examples where you've supported or guided other engineers. Highlight your leadership style and how you can help raise the technical bar for the team while fostering a collaborative environment.